Abstract

Let E be a real Banach space with a uniformly Gâteaux differentiable norm possessing uniform normal structure, C a nonempty closed bounded convex subset of E. By using viscosity approximation methods for a finite family of asymptotically non-expansive mappings, sufficient and necessary conditions for the iterative sequence to converging to the common fixed point are obtained. The results presented in the paper improve and generalize known results in the literature.
